Lifestyle & Amenities
Life in Friendship revolves around the great outdoors and community connection. The area is a paradise for hikers, mountain bikers, and equestrians, with direct access to the famed trails of DuPont Forest, including Hooker Falls and Triple Falls. Nearby, the Cedar Mountain community center and volunteer fire department serve as hubs for local events and gatherings. While feeling remote, you're never far from essentials and delights.
For dining and supplies, residents frequent the charming local spots in Cedar Mountain and venture a short drive into Brevard or Hendersonville for a wider array of restaurants, boutique shopping, and cultural activities like the Brevard Music Center. The area also boasts several local vineyards and apple orchards, perfect for weekend outings. The lifestyle is one of balanced simplicity, where stunning natural amenities are your backyard.
Real Estate Market
The real estate market in Friendship offers remarkable value for those seeking a mountain retreat or a permanent home surrounded by nature. The market is characterized by a mix of rustic cabins, charming modular homes, and custom-built houses on wooded lots, often with mountain views or creek frontage. The median home value here is approximately $115,500, presenting an accessible entry point compared to many other mountain communities.
Market Insight: With a median household income of around $54,265, the area provides a financially sustainable lifestyle. Properties often feature larger, private lots, offering seclusion without complete isolation. This market attracts those looking for affordability, space, and a genuine connection to the Southern Appalachian landscape.
Schools & Education
Families in Friendship are served by the Transylvania County School District, known for its strong community involvement and quality education. Students typically attend Brevard Elementary, Brevard Middle, and Brevard High School, all located in the nearby county seat of Brevard. These schools offer robust academic programs, arts, and athletics, often leveraging the unique natural environment for experiential learning.
Brevard, also known as "The Land of Waterfalls," provides additional educational resources including the Brevard Music Center Institute and the nearby Pisgah Forest for environmental education. For higher education, residents have access to Blue Ridge Community College in Flat Rock and a short commute to several four-year universities in Asheville and Greenville, SC.
Transportation & Connectivity
Friendship is connected by scenic mountain roads, primarily US Highway 276 and Everett Road. The commute to Brevard takes about 15-20 minutes, making it convenient for work, school, and shopping. While the area feels wonderfully remote, it is strategically located between major hubs: roughly 45 minutes south of Asheville, 45 minutes north of Greenville, South Carolina, and about 90 minutes from the Asheville Regional Airport (AVL).
It's important to note that internet and cellular service can vary significantly by specific location, with some areas relying on satellite or fixed wireless solutions. However, ongoing infrastructure improvements are gradually enhancing connectivity. For most residents, the trade-off of slightly slower internet for immense natural beauty and peace is more than worthwhile.

Friendship Market Data
| Metric | Value |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Median Home Price | $116K |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Median Gross Rent | $855/mo |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Median Household Income | $54K |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Homeownership Rate | 80.8%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Renter-Occupied | 19.3%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Rental Vacancy Rate | 8.6%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Market Type | Buyer's |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
